Third inquiry into former Spanish king
SPANISH Supreme Court prosecutors have opened a third corruption investigation involving former monarch Juan Carlos I of Spain, officials said.
Attorney general Dolores Delgado and top anti-corruption prosecutor Alejandro Luzon told reporters the probe is still at an “embryonic” stage, private news agency Europa Press reported.
They said the investigation was triggered by “financial information” but declined to elaborate, Europa Press said.
Earlier this week, prosecutors announced a second investigation into Juan Carlos’ finances.
The former king was already the target of inquiries in Spain and Switzerland for possible financial wrongdoing. Those prompted him to leave Spain in August.
